Average Testing Technician Salary in China for 2026

A testing technician in China earns about 215,100 CNY a year. That's 39% below the national average of 351,900 CNY.

Pay ranges widely from country to country and from role to role. The lowest reported salaries in China sit around 108,340 CNY a year, while the very top stretches to 332,500 CNY. How testing technician pay ranges in China

A good way to think about salary in China is to look at the distribution rather than the headline average. Half of all testing technicians in China earn less than 209,500 CNY a year, and the other half earn more. That middle number is the median, and it is usually more useful than the average for answering "is my pay normal here".

Looking at the quartiles fills in the picture. A quarter of earners take home less than 146,200 CNY (the 25th percentile), and a quarter clear 266,000 CNY (the 75th percentile). The middle 50% of testing technicians sit somewhere inside that band, which is where the typical reader of this page probably lives.

The very lowest reported salaries sit around 108,340 CNY. The highest stretch to 332,500 CNY, though only a small fraction of earners ever reach that level. Testing technician pay by experience in China

Years of experience is the single biggest lever on pay for a testing technician in China, ahead of education and almost any other single factor. The longer you have been in the role, the more your employer can trust you to handle complexity, mentor others and act independently, all of which command higher pay. The chart below shows how the typical testing technician salary changes as you move through the career ladder.

  • 0-2 Years
    125,100 CNY
  • 2-5 Years
    +27% from previous
    159,500 CNY
  • 5-10 Years
    +41% from previous
    225,300 CNY
  • 10-15 Years
    +21% from previous
    272,800 CNY
  • 15-20 Years
    +8% from previous
    294,700 CNY
  • 20+ Years
    +8% from previous
    318,800 CNY

The single largest jump on the ladder is from 2 - 5 Years to 5 - 10 Years, where pay rises by about 41%. That is the point at which a testing technician typically goes from "competent in the role" to "the person other people in the team learn from", and the market pays well for that step.

Testing technician gender pay gap in China

The gender pay gap is a stubborn feature of almost every labour market, and China is no exception. Male testing technicians in China earn an average of 227,600 CNY a year, while female testing technicians earn around 204,000 CNY. That works out to a 12% gap in favour of men, even when comparing people doing the same work.

A pay gap of this size has a real long-term cost. Over a typical thirty-year career it can add up to several years of pay, and it compounds through pensions, retirement contributions and bonus-linked stock. Some of the gap is explained by women being more likely to work part-time, take career breaks, or be steered toward lower-paying specialisations. Some of it is straightforward unequal pay for the same job, which is harder to defend.

Testing technician bonus rates in China

Bonuses are the other half of total compensation, and they vary a lot between jobs and industries. Some roles are paid almost entirely in base salary; others lean heavily on bonus structures tied to revenue, project completion or company performance. Whether a job pays a bonus, how big it is, and how often it lands all factor into whether the headline salary is actually a good offer.

29%

29% of testing technicians in China reported a bonus of some kind in the past twelve months. That makes a testing technician a low-bonus role overall, which is useful context when you're weighing up a job offer where the base is below market.

Among those who did receive a bonus, the size of the payment varied substantially. Reported bonuses ranged from 1% to 3% of base salary. The remaining 71% of testing technicians reported no bonus at all over the same period.
